There are a couple issues with the current description:
1) The msm8996 compatible is wholly reused, without a SM6125-specific
primary compatible
2) MSM8996 has a different power setup (VDD powered through a RPMPD
power-domain vs a regulator)
3) MSM8996 uses a different init sequence
As part of fixing all of them, use a SM6125-specific compatible with a
SM6115 fallback.
